Features of Copper Tubing Type L

Type L Copper Tubing is known for its specific characteristics that make it appropriate for food and beverage applications:

1. Corrosion Resistance:

Copper is naturally corrosion-resistant, and Copper Tubing Type L is no different. It can tolerate the effects of corrosion of various food and beverage products, including acids and basic solutions, guaranteeing the durability of the tubing and the cleanliness of the transported substances.

2. Antimicrobial Properties:

Copper has inherent antimicrobial properties, making it capable against a wide range of bacteria, fungi, and viruses. Type L Copper Tubing can help inhibit the growth of harmful microorganisms, promoting hygiene and food safety in the processing and transportation of food and beverages.

3. Easy to Clean:

Type L Copper Tubing has a smooth inner surface, which makes it effortless to clean and maintain. Its non-porous nature prevents the accumulation of dirt, debris, or bacteria, facilitating effective cleaning and sanitation procedures.

4. High Thermal Conductivity:

Copper is an excellent carrier of heat, allowing for efficient temperature control in food and beverage processes. Type L Copper Tubing helps maintain desired temperatures during production, storage, and transportation, ensuring product quality and safety.

The Importance of Water Leak Detection Shut Off Valves

Water shut off valves with leak detection features perform several important purposes:

1. Swift Leak Detection:

Valves with leak detection capabilities can quickly identify even the minor water leaks. This permits you to take prompt measures and minimize potential harm before it becomes a serious problem.

2. Automatic Water Shut Off:

When a leak is spotted, water shut off valves with leak detection features can automatically shut off the water supply to halt additional water flow. This function is especially valuable in scenarios where the property may be unoccupied or if you are unable to take action promptly to the leak.

3. Protecting Your Property from Water Damage:

By quickly shutting off the water supply in the occasion of a leak, these valves assist stop water damage to your property, such as flooding, mold growth, and constructional problems. This can save you from expensive repairs and insurance claims.

Features of Leak Detection Water Shut Off Valves

Water shut off valves with leak detection features come with several important characteristics that make them efficient in protecting your property:

1. Cutting-Edge Sensor Technology:

These valves are equipped with state-of-the-art sensors that can detect water leaks or abnormal water flow patterns. The sensors are typically placed in tactical locations, such as near appliances, under sinks, or in basements, where leaks are more likely to occur.

2. Automatic Shut Off:

When a leak is identified, the valve is designed to self-automatically shut off the water supply. This averts additional water flow and potential detriment until the problem can be fixed.

3. Remote Supervision and Management:

Many leak detection water shut off valves offer remote monitoring and control functions. This allows you to observe the status of your water supply, receive warnings in case of a leak, and even remotely shut off the water supply from your smartphone or computer.

4. Battery Redundancy:

To ensure ongoing operation even during power outages, leak detection water shut off valves often incorporate battery backup systems. This assures that the valve remains functional and can shut off the water supply, providing an extra layer of security.

Pin Lock vs. Ball Lock: Selecting the Appropriate System for Your Homebrewing Setup

When it comes to homebrewing, the decision of kegging systems can greatly affect the simplicity and productivity of your brewing procedure. Two well-liked choices for linking and dispensing beer are pin lock and ball lock systems. In this article, we will compare pin lock and ball lock kegging systems, exploring their attributes, advantages, and considerations to help you make an informed selection for your homebrewing setup.

Pin Lock Vs.Ball Lock

Pin Lock Kegging System

Pin lock kegs, also known as Coca-Cola® kegs, are distinguished by their unique pin-locking mechanism. These kegs have tiny pins on the posts that link to the keg fittings. Here are some important features of pin lock kegs:

1. Connectivity:

Pin lock kegs use a distinct connector system compared to ball lock kegs. The posts on pin lock kegs have both gas and liquid connections, each with a unique pin configuration. This means that the gas and liquid lines are not interchangeable, and specific fittings are required.

2. Availability:

Pin lock kegs were broadly used by soda manufacturers in the past, making them more popular in the United States. They are still conveniently available, particularly as used or refurbished kegs.

3. Durability:

Pin lock kegs are known for their strong construction, making them durable and lasting. They are typically made of stainless steel, which is resistant to corrosion and maintains the quality of your beer.

Ball Lock Kegging System

Ball lock kegs, commonly referred to as Pepsi® kegs, use a distinct type of locking mechanism compared to pin lock kegs. Instead of pins, ball lock kegs use ball-bearing connectors. Let’s explore some essential features of ball lock kegs:

1. Connectivity:

Ball lock kegs have two different posts for gas and liquid connections, but unlike pin lock kegs, these posts use a universal design. This means that the gas and liquid lines are interchangeable, allowing for greater flexibility and convenience.

2. Availability:

Ball lock kegs have gained popularity in recent years, becoming the more common kegging system among homebrewers. They are widely available both as new and used options, and their accessories and replacement parts are also readily accessible.

3. Versatility:

Ball lock kegs offer greater versatility in terms of compatibility with different fittings and connectors. This makes them a preferred selection for homebrewers who value flexibility and ease of use.
